RESPONSIVE ACTIVATION OF A VEHICLE FEATURE
One general aspect includes a system for responsive activation of a vehicle feature for a vehicle, the system includes: an audio system configured to announce information and the vehicle feature; a memory configured to include one or more executable instructions; a controller configured to execute the executable instructions, and where the executable instructions enable the controller to: receive speech inputs from a vehicle occupant located in the vehicle, the speech inputs regarding the vehicle feature; retrieve vehicle feature information from vehicle feature information databases, in response to the received speech inputs; provide audio description information for the vehicle feature information; determine whether at least one received speech input includes a feature activation request; provide vehicle feature activation information to the vehicle feature, in response to a positive determination that the at least one received speech input includes the feature activation request.

Navigation assistance from a trusted device
Systems and methods of facilitating screen sharing of a user's computing device with a trusted contact are provided. A user may receive directions while driving by calling a friend and initiating a screen sharing support session during which a software application currently displayed on the user's device is transmitted for real-time display on the friend's device. The friend may provide control inputs to be executed by the software application on the user's computing device.
DOOR ENTRY SYSTEMS AND METHODS
Various implementations include systems and methods for unlocking a door to a building on behalf of a tenant of the building that addresses the shortcomings of legacy telephone entry systems and allows for more efficient and safer management of building entry requests from third parties. In some implementations, the system taps into the legacy telephone entry systems to communicate with third parties seeking entry into the building. In some implementations, the system communicates with third party computing devices (e.g., stationary or mobile devices) to process entry requests. And, in some implementations, the system communicates entry preferences (or parameters) associated with a tenant with a door lock system to allow for entry during certain time windows or under certain conditions.
Multiple device and multiple line connected home and home monitoring
Systems, devices, and techniques for multiple device and multiple line enabled computing devices and computing appliances are described herein. A device number can be assigned to a computing device and can be unique to the computing device. A plurality of alias numbers can be provided to the computing device and enabled for use by the computing device. Alias numbers can be enabled on multiple computing appliances, such that a user can transfer voice or video calls between devices using the alias numbers. Further, monitoring components in a home environment, for example, can be associated with one or more alias number so that security alerts can be provided to the various computing devices and computing appliances associated with the alias numbers.

Voice control of remote device by disabling wakeword detection
A system configured to enable remote control to allow a first user to provide assistance to a second user. The system may receive a command from the second user granting remote control to the first user, enabling the first user to initiate a voice command on behalf of the second user. In some examples, the system may enable the remote control by treating a voice command originating from the first user as though it originated from the second user instead. For example, the system may receive the voice command from a first device associated with the first user but may route the voice command as though it was received by a second device associated with the second user. To enable this functionality, during a remote control session the first device may disable wakeword detection so that the voice command is correctly routed to the second device.
DEVICE RESTRICTIONS DURING EVENTS
A system and method for controlling functions on devices is disclosed. An occurrence of a start of an event is determined. Based on determining the occurrence of the start, a respective registration of a respective device associated with a respective attendee of the event is received. Based on receiving the respective registration and determining the occurrence of the start of the event, temporary restrictions are applied to the respective device from which the respective registration is received. Based on determining an occurrence of an end of the event, the temporary restrictions are removed from the respective device.
Safety of a mobile communications device
Systems and methods for improving safety of a multi-function portable personal communications device can include determining a first position of the personal communications device, after a predetermined time interval, determining a second position of the personal communications device, determining the distance between the first position and the second position, determining the time interval in which the personal communications device moved from the first position and the second position, calculating an average velocity of the personal communications device based on the first position, the second position and the time interval and, if the average velocity of the personal communication device exceeds a predetermined value, sending an alert or inhibiting a function of the personal communications device. Other systems and methods that improve safety are also disclosed.
